By: Jill Clayton | 2013-04-13 | Home improvement A solar non-profit, Singularity Solar Energy, works to bring solar energy to low-income homeowners to help them cut costs and to protect the environment. They recently provided one residence in the Dallas area with solar panels for their home. The solar donation was made possible in part due to a monetary donation by Green Mountain Energy Sun Club and the installation help of Habitat for Humanity read more
